This week it is all things yoga props, equipment & accessories. Walking into a yoga class can be daunting whether new to yoga, new to a particular class or simply feeling a little tired before you step onto your mat.

 

Yoga equipment is a great way to help ease into your postures and practice & something to be grabbed by both hands! There can be a feeling of am I doing it right, shall I only pick up my yoga brick when everyone else does... Using your yoga brick, block or bolster at any time will only enhance your practice not hinder, to help you find that little extra stretch, balance or stability to get the most of your postures. YOGA BLOCK


ree

Place your yoga block underneath your glutes, sitting on the front edge to tilt your pelvis anteriorly to enhance your posture & alignment. Gently stretching the hamstrings & glutes shall improve your posture!


YOGA BRICK


ree

Place your hand on a yoga brick upright, sideways or flat to lessen the gap to the floor. It shall ensure your alignment is not compromised & by slowly lowering the brick you shall be able to work on a gentle stretch rather than arching/ bending towards aches/ pains from compensating muscles to correct balance/ posture.


YOGA BOLSTER


ree

Placing a bolster between your chest and legs in postures such as Intense Stretch of the West, can provide comfort if suffering with pain or less elasticity in the spine/ lower back to hold the posture more comfortably. Gently releasing the bolster can work on your stretch more gently to prevent injuries
